A Lovely Story To Help Educate Our Mind: the faithful dog Hatchi.

A couple had been married for several years

without a child. For the purpose of

companionship, they bought a Rottweiler puppy,

named it Hatchi and loved her like a child. The

dog had access to all the rooms in the house.

The puppy grew to become a large, beautiful dog

and had on several occasions saved d couples

from robbery. Hatchi was always faithful, loyal

and defended its owners against any danger.

Seven years later, the couple was blessed to

have the long-

awaited son. They were very happy with their

new son and decreased the

attention they had been giving the dog. Hatchi

felt neglected and began to get jealous

of the baby.

One day the couple left the baby sleeping

peacefully in his cradle and went to

the terrace to prepare a roast. They were

shocked as they were heading

to the nursery and saw Hatchi in the hallway

with a bloody mouth, wagging its tail. The dog's

owner thought the worst, pulled out a weapon

and immediately killed the dog. Rushed to the

baby's room and found a beheaded snake close

to the baby. The owner begins to mourn and

exclaims I killed my faithful dog!

How often have we misjudged people without

finding out facts.

The next time we are tempered to judge and

condemn anyone remember the

story of a faithful dog Hatchi.
